How would you describe what you did at General Technology Company?

Responsible for developing sales and marketing plan for young start up company. Brought unique Check Cashing System to market in 8 states with emphasis on the Cleveland market where over 200 units were placed in the first 10 months. Created strong customer base to which new products and services where up-sold. These included Bill Pay Machines, ATM's, Cash Registers, Mobile GPS Tracking Systems and Collection Service. Made initial contact, set appointments and presentations to top level government agencies and officials which included the U.S. Department of Commerce, FBI, Homeland Security, FinCEN, Governors of 3 states and the Cleveland City Council. Secured distributorship rights for Bill Payment System with IPP, Inc. Was in charge of marketing and national and international sales of GPS Tracking Device in US, Saudi Arabia, UAE, Jordan, Canada and Haiti. Developed highly effective marketing through nationwide publication of Newsletter and multiple websites. Developed all company marketing materials including pamphlets, direct mail pieces brochures and product catalogue.
